The next list compares two colleges briefly in important perspectives. You can compare two colleges with comprehensive information on the full comparison page.
  • Both schools are four-years, public schools.
  • Miami of Ohio has more expensive tuition & fees ($40,025) than Central Michigan University ($14,190).
  • It is harder to admit to Central Michigan University than Miami of Ohio.
  • Miami of Ohio has a higher submitted SAT score (1,290) than Central Michigan University (1,090).
  • Miami of Ohio has higher submitted ACT score (28) than Central Michigan University (24).
  • Miami of Ohio has more students with 19,107 students while Central Michigan University has 14,557 students.
  • Miami of Ohio has a lower number of students per faculty with 15 to 1 while Central Michigan University's ratio is 17 to 1.
  • Miami of Ohio has more full-time faculties with 857 faculties while Central Michigan University has 717 full-time faculties.
